FMNA Taps Dinsmore For Alternative Chief

Former NBC and CMT executive Jayson Dinsmore will oversee FremantleMedia North America’s domestic and global development strategy.

FremantleMedia North America (FMNA) has appointed television industry veteran, Jayson Dinsmore, as the company’s president of alternative programming and development.  In his new role, Dinsmore will be charged with driving the company’s domestic and global development strategy within the unscripted genre. 

“Jayson is one of the most well-respected and admired executives within the television industry,” said Jennifer Mullin, FMNA CEO. “He is innovative, creative and brings an enormous amount of experience in both development and production.   He shares our ambition at FMNA and I am delighted to have him lead our unscripted team.

In this new role, Dinsmore will focus on sourcing, developing, pitching and producing original programming. With current hits such as America’s Got Talent (NBC), Family Feud (syndicated), The Price Is Right (CBS), Match Game (ABC) and American Idol (ABC), Dinsmore will have access to both FMNA’s back catalogue of titles, as well as the opportunity to make key strategic, talent and creative decisions regarding new formats to further enhance the company’s pipeline of entertainment. 

Dinsmore comes to FMNA with an extensive background in television and media. Most recently, he has been executive vice president of production and development for CMT, where he managed all facets of development and genres including unscripted, scripted, news, documentaries and music events. During his tenure at CMT, he redefined the brand’s creative filter and launched shows including, Party Down South, Nashville and Sun Records

Prior to his role at CMT, Dinsmore spent over a decade at NBC Entertainment, where he served as both the SVP and VP of alternative programming and development. During his time there, he was responsible for shows including Deal or No Deal, The Sing-Off and Minute To Win It

He is a native of Texas and graduated from Howard Payne University.
